Artist's Description

Vintage Paris Ice Palace , Ice skating Jules Cheret
Beautifully re-retouched in 2016.
Jules Cheret, 1896, for the Ice Palace (Palais De Glace) on the Champs Elysees in Paris. A man and woman in late 19th century winter fashion are skating.
Color scheme: brilliant red (dress), light brilliant gamboge (yellow dress), dark phthalo blue (text), moderate orange brown (fur left), Light vermilion (fur right)
Jules Cheret (May 31, 1836 � September 23, 1932) was a French painter and lithographer who became a master of Belle epoque poster art. He has been called the father of the modern poster.
